On 30 March 2011, the Security Council adopted resolution 1975 in which:
— it urges Gbagbo to immediately step aside,
— it stresses its full support given to UNOCI to use "all necessary means to carry out its mandate to protect civilians (…) including to prevent the use of heavy weapons "
— it imposes targeted sanctions (freezing of assets, travel bans) against Laurent Gbagbo, his wife Simone Gbagbo, the Secretary General of the so-called "presidency" Mr. Désiré Tagro, the chairman of the Ivorian Popular Front Pascal Affi N’Guessan ;
— it recognizes the jurisdiction of the International Criminal Court to try perpetrators of serious crimes in Côte d’Ivoire ;
— it makes explicit reference to the responsibility to protect.
